The Green Pin Tycan® Lifting Chain is a revolutionary lightweight lifting chain made from Dyneema® fiber — up to 80% lighter than steel chain at equivalent capacity. Tycan® chain is designed for overhead lifting and chain sling fabrication where weight savings dramatically improve handling, reduce operator fatigue, and increase productivity.

Key Features
- Up to 80% lighter than equivalent steel chain
- Dyneema® fiber construction — does not rust or corrode
- Flexible and easy to handle — reduces operator fatigue
- Will not damage loads or finished surfaces
- EN 818-2 compliant for overhead lifting
- Individually proof tested with certificate
- Full material traceability
Available Sizes
- 11 × 15 mm — WLL 2.6 metric tons (5,730 lbs)
- 11 × 20 mm — WLL 4.0 metric tons (8,820 lbs)
- 13 × 30 mm — WLL 6.8 metric tons (14,990 lbs)
- 15 × 25 mm — WLL 5.0 metric tons (11,020 lbs)
Common Applications
- Chain sling fabrication — lighter slings for easier rigging
- Overhead crane and hoist lifting
- Marine and offshore — corrosion-free alternative to steel chain
- Any application where steel chain weight is a limiting factor
Why Tycan®?
Steel chain is heavy, rusts, and can damage loads. Tycan® Dyneema® chain eliminates all three problems while maintaining full lifting capacity. Sling fabricators can build assemblies that riggers actually want to use — lighter to carry, easier to rig, and gentler on load surfaces.

Governing Standards
- ASME B30.9 — slings (web, round, wire rope, chain) inspection and use
- ASME B30.26 — rigging hardware (shackles, eye bolts, links, turnbuckles)
- ASME B30.10 — hooks
- OSHA 1910.184 and 1926.251 — general industry and construction sling safety
- WSTDA WS-2 and RS-1 — web and round sling design
- 49 CFR 393.102 to 393.130 — DOT cargo tie-down
- NACM — welded steel chain grade specs
Inspection & Safety
Before every use: visual check for cracks, corrosion, distortion, wear, and illegible markings. Annually (minimum): documented periodic inspection by a trained inspector. Remove from service at first sign of damage. Never repair rigging hardware by welding, heating, or bending.
